Re: USB ports going away during match

Here's a few ideas:

-Turn off the power save setting. This has caused similar problems for some teams in the past

-Uninstall and reinstall the USB driver

-Make sure that there is no other USB device that could be shorting the USB 5V supply.

-Make sure the contacts on the USB connectors are not corroded or dirty

-Make sure the USB cable fits snugly. If it doesn't, you can try gently crushing the joystick connector so that it has a better fit.

-Make sure the laptop is plugged in when you're driving.

-Make sure the laptop battery is healthy. Bad batteries can cause really weird things to happen.

-Uninstall/Reinstall the USB driver

-Disable your wireless adapter and bluetooth (if you have it). Sometimes the bluetooth adapter connects to an internal usb port, and may be causing issues.
